Output 31498b6eb06a9906086a695899cbf9b653dd7d4bf47f52b0d780b61c0e623304:0

value
3260000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cec6b8a809a87de8892effcc36827818497104b OP_EQUALVERIFY OP_CHECKSIG
address
1Dr8pcUEqustd5FayR2aZHgwmkD1eMp8zC
transaction
31498b6eb06a9906086a695899cbf9b653dd7d4bf47f52b0d780b61c0e623304
spent
true